转自:://blog..net/wuxunfeng/article/details/5286540 平时对网络编程方面比较感兴趣,看了一些相关的资料,自己也尝试写过一些不同网络模型的服务程序。这次刚好有一个新的需求,需要开发一个转发服务器。之前开发的项目,网络通讯都是处理联机交易的,网络连接都是采用短连接,这次的服务端,采用长连接的方式。1. 轮询和主动通知选择 公司有一个客户产品(CLIENT),因为需要从多个客户的服务端获(SERVER)取信息,原有的设计是每个客户通过SOCKET不断的轮询访问服务端获取信息。当CLIENT的数量不多时,轮询访问对服务端压力不大,但是.